AbstractEducation is of great importance for all individuals in a society from the very beginning. Individuals have regarded education as the most important way to achieve their goals. In this context, university education, which prepares individuals to work life, has an important place in all societies. However, although individuals start university with great hopes, after a while, concerns and question marks about the future begin. At this point, activities that will contribute to the effective career planning of university students and guiding them on become important. The aim of the present study was to analyze the views of pre-service Turkish language teachers on their careers and career plans. Phenomenology, one of qualitative research methods, was adopted in the study. The study group included 64 pre-service teachers studying at Turkish Language Education department in a large-scale university in the east of Turkey. An interview form which included 4 open-ended questions and was developed by the researcher was used to collect data. The data were analyzed using descriptive analysis. The findings demonstrated that the majority of the participants did not have an effective career plan; they lacked knowledge on their respective fields of study, and their career plans generally focused on teaching and academic professions.
